chatgpt 多轮对话(多轮对话数据集)
聊天机器人多轮对话数据集
聊天机器人多轮对话数据集是用于训练聊天机器人的一种数据集,它包含了多个轮次的对话样本,可以用来提高聊天机器人的对话能力和上下文理解能力。我们将详细阐述聊天机器人多轮对话数据集的特点、应用场景、构建方法、训练技巧以及未来发展方向等方面。
特点
聊天机器人多轮对话数据集具有以下几个特点:
1. 上下文连贯:与单轮对话相比,多轮对话数据集能够提供更多的上下文信息,使得机器人能够更好地理解用户的意图和需求。
2. 多样性:多轮对话数据集中包含了各种各样的对话场景和话题,使得机器人能够适应不同的对话情境,并提供更加个性化的回复。
3. 高质量:多轮对话数据集通常经过严格的筛选和标注,确保了对话的质量和准确性,提高了机器人的对话效果。
应用场景
聊天机器人多轮对话数据集在多个应用场景中发挥着重要作用,包括但不限于以下几个方面:
1. 客服机器人:多轮对话数据集可以用于训练客服机器人,帮助用户解决问题和提供咨询服务,提升客户体验和效率。
2. 智能助手:多轮对话数据集可以用于构建智能助手,帮助用户处理日常事务、获取信息和提供个性化建议。
3. 教育培训:多轮对话数据集可以用于开发教育培训机器人,帮助学生学习和解答问题,提供个性化的学习指导。
构建方法
构建聊天机器人多轮对话数据集的方法多种多样,常见的方法包括人工标注、对话模拟和数据爬取等。
1. 人工标注:通过人工参与对话并进行标注,将对话数据转化为多轮对话数据集。这种方法通常需要耗费大量的人力和时间,但能够保证对话的质量和准确性。
2. 对话模拟:通过设计对话场景和角色,模拟多轮对话,并进行记录和整理。这种方法相对简单快捷,但对话的真实性和多样性可能有所欠缺。
3. 数据爬取:通过爬取互联网上的对话数据,筛选和整理成多轮对话数据集。这种方法可以获取大量的对话数据,但需要进行数据清洗和去重,确保数据的质量和可用性。
训练技巧
在使用聊天机器人多轮对话数据集进行训练时,可以采用以下一些技巧来提高训练效果:
1. 上下文编码:使用适当的编码方式,将多轮对话中的上下文信息转化为机器可理解的表示形式,如向量或张量。
2. 上下文记忆:在训练过程中,引入记忆机制,使得机器能够记住之前的对话内容,并根据上下文进行回复。
3. 对话策略:设计合理的对话策略,根据用户的意图和上下文信息,选择合适的回复方式和语言风格。
未来发展方向
聊天机器人多轮对话数据集的发展方向主要包括以下几个方面:
1. 多模态对话:将文本对话与语音、图像等多种模态信息相结合,提供更加丰富和真实的对话体验。
2. 强化学习:引入强化学习方法,通过与用户的实时交互,不断优化机器人的对话策略和回复效果。
3. 零样本学习:实现在没有大量标注数据的情况下,仍能够进行有效训练和对话的能力,提高机器人的泛化能力和适应性。
聊天机器人多轮对话数据集在提升机器人对话能力方面具有重要作用。随着技术的不断进步和数据集的不断丰富,聊天机器人将能够更好地理解用户需求,提供更加智能化和个性化的对话服务。